Waiting For A Princess metal print by Carol Eade. Bring your artwork to life with the stylish lines and added depth of a metal print. Your image gets printed directly onto a sheet of 1/16" thick aluminum. The aluminum sheet is offset from the wall by a 3/4" thick wooden frame which is attached to the back. The high gloss of the aluminum sheet complements the rich colors of any image to produce stunning results.

All of the times I've gone to the wetlands over the years, I've never been able to spot a frog. Thank you to a fellow photographer for pointing this one out to me. I love his eyes. The american bullfrog is a true frog, best known for its large size and its loud call. It became known as the bullfrog because its loud call resembles the mooing of a cow. Did you know the female can lay up to 20,000 eggs?

About Carol Eade
My camera enables me to artistically express my love for nature and art. Although I find great joy just being behind the lens, my heart sings when I'm able to capture the beauty and magic of nature. I find inspiration in many places but I'm mostly inspired by paintings. I enjoy challenging myself to make pictures that look like paintings. Some of the techniques I use are long exposure, intentional camera movement and shooting through objects in the foreground. I'm visually attracted to warm light, curvy lines and water. Elements that define my style are rich color, rich tones, textures and clean backgrounds.
